The company's chairman of the board of directors of Google, Eric Schmidt announced that the biggest competitor in the search engines on the market at the time, even Microsoft's Bing or Yahoo, as was previously thought possible, and the Amazon. It E.Schmidt told, during his visit to Berlin (Germany).

Amazon is well known as an e-commerce titan, but when Internet users perform a lot of queries. Some users are looking for products through search engines (like Google), while others go directly to the Amazon home page and looking for it directly.

Another survey conducted in August showed that Google is the most popular Web page to 233.1 million. unique users visiting here at least once a month, while Amazon has 6 place with 172 million. visitors.
